Abstract
In response to a possible need of industry to perform the automatic symbolic generation of feedback laws on computers, this paper presents a generator which is based on FORM, i.e., a symbolic math code. The version 1.0 is used to derive automatically the non-linear control laws leading to decoupling and exact linearization by feedback. To run the program, the user entries are the dynamics of the system, the non-linear output vector to be controlled and the underlying characteristic numbers. Finally, as this code works sequentially, there is no limitation of the size of physical systems to be handled by this program, even when using PCs.
